The story of Quinlan

Oklahoma's ghost towns got it from both sides — oil booms that built them overnight and the Dust Bowl that emptied them.

Quinlan is an unincorporated community in Woodward County, Oklahoma, United States. As of the 2020 census, Quinlan had a population of 28. It is located on what was the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railroad, 9 miles (14 km) east of Mooreland. Quinlan began as a small agricultural community, and is old enough to appear on a 1911 Rand McNally map of the county.
